WEINMANN Emergency buys Tech2Go

Medical technology firm WEINMANN Emergency has taken over the staff and MedicalPad product from Tech2Go Mobile Systems GmbH in a move that will allow the Hamburg-based business to expand its digital services offering

Andre Schulte, CEO of WEINMANN Emergency, commented on the deal: “The employees, expertise and products of Tech2go will boost our competence in the provision of digital services – and not just for the monitoring/defibrillation product line.” MedicalPad has been recording patient transport, rescue service and emergency physician incident reports in digital form for 20 years already.

Covid-19 has resulted in a significant boost to telemedicine services, including in first response, and WEINMANN can utilize the MedicalPad product range to focus on networking, data management and telemedicine solutions, as well as expanding incident data management and device management applications.

Previous partnership results in new developments

Tech2go and WEINMANN Emergency have been collaborating for some time now on the development of an online portal for the transmission of device data relating to the incident. As the Hamburg-based company is undergoing a period of rapid growth, the recently acquired Tech2go staff and their new colleagues from Monitoring/Defibrillation will move into newly-rented office space. This new team will collaborate on the continuing development of digital incident data management and device management applications for WEINMANN Emergency.
